History
Chronology:

1856 Ran the Toronto-Kingston-Ogdensburg route.

1857-58 Owned Detroit & Milwaukee Railroad Co.

1858, Sep 15 Certificate of ownership cancelled by letter from Collector of Customs, Quebec.

1859, Jan 19 Admitted into US Registry, New York City; renamed COATZACOALCOS.

1859 Measured 285'6" x 38' 4" x 14'; 1683 tons.

1858-60 Owned Peter A. Hargous, New York.

1860-62 Owned Marshall O. Roberts.

During Civil War- Charterd by U.S. War Department for use along Atlantic Coast & Gulf of Mexico.

1862, Sep 24 Renamed AMERICA.

1862 Rebuilt, owned People's Line; went to Nicaragua.

1863 Went to Pacific to run San Francisco-Panama Route.

1864-66 Owned Central American Transit Co.; San Francisco-Nicaragua Route.

1866-68 Owned North American Steamship Co.

1868-69 Owned Pacific Mail Steamship Co.; San Franciso-San Diego- Mexican ports.

1869, Apr 11 Burned.
